Low Dropout (LDO) Linear Voltage Regulators, 450mA, ON Semiconductor
LDO (Low Dropout) Linear Voltage Regulators, ON Semiconductor
The Low dropout or LDO is a linear voltage regulator. We have a wide range of linear regulators. The LDO regulator can operate with a small input–output differential voltage. LDO voltage regulators may offer fast transient response, wide input voltage range, low quiescent current and low noise with high PSRR.
